  • Open iTunes Library on another computer

    My entire music library is on my external hard drive. I'm going away for the summber and obviously I can't take my iMac with me. But I've got PB. And, I'd like to open my music library in my PB exactly like I do on my iMac, i.e. same play count, same import date, etc... The reason I ask this is because the only way I know how to open the music library on another computer, is to import the entire library again, which will not retain all that information (play count, etc). So, how do I do that?

    Here's the trick. On your PB, Rename your user/music/iTunes folder (something like iTunesb or anything similar). When you launch iTunes, it will freak out and tell you that it can't find your music library and ask you to "point to" the correct location. From there simply navigate to your iTunes folder on your ext. drive and bingo..... Of course, this means that you must have the drive mounted whenever you launch iTunes. Also, you will have to "authorize" the PB to play your purchased music.

  • Transferring my Itune account (with song library) to another computer

    I need to transfer my Itune to another computer which I am going to connect the same ipod. How am I going to do it so that I will still have my songs?
    Thanks.

    I don't have Match but I think it just deals with iTems on an individual basis.
    There is:
    iTunes: How to move [or copy] your music [library] to a new computer [or another drive] - http://support.apple.com/kb/HT4527
    Quick answer if you use iTunes' default preferences settings:  Copy the entire iTunes folder (and in doing so all its subfolders and files) intact to the other drive.  Open iTunes and immediately hold down the Option (alt) key (shift on Windows), then guide it to the new location of the library.
    Windows users see tip at: https://discussions.apple.com/message/18879381
    The above places the whole library on a different computer but is a bit much to do on a regular basis.

  • I've moved my Aperture library to another computer, and masters are referencing an old path name.  How can I update these references?  Reloctating masters does not work in this case :(

    I've moved my Aperture library from one computer to another using Finder.
    I merged the library with one which was already on the computer.
    Now, the photos I imported have reference to the old path name on my old computer.
    How can I update these references as "Relocate Masters" does not work in this case?

    Just one suggestion to be able to reconnect all at once:
    Create a smart album containing the images with missing masters:
    File -> New ->  Smart Album,     and add a rule: File Status is "Missing"     (or File Status is "offline")
    Then select the images in this album and go to the File menu:
    and select:   File -> Locate referenced File
    If you are lucky, Aperture will reconnect all at once, if you point the first image version to its counterpart.
